OZ Lotto has jackpotted to an incredible $70 million after no ticket from across the country matched the numbers to tonight’s Division One prize.
Lotterywest spokesperson James Mooney said it would be great to see the $70 million prize shared by a group of WA players.
“A significant jackpot is the perfect opportunity to organise a syndicate of family, friends or workmates to share the cost of a ticket and possibly the joy of a win,” he said.
While tonight’s draw didn’t result in a Division One winner, across the State more than 96,000 OZ Lotto players shared in prizes across other divisions, including a Division Two win.
Tonight’s Division Two winning ticket is now worth more than $49,000 and was sold from Morley Millions.
The good news for WA continues with more than $6.8 million contributing to Lotterywest’s grants program over the six-week OZ Lotto jackpot roll.
